Market analysis of the Imported Sesame & Market of China

Market Report:

The imported sesame prices are reduced compared with that in the last week end. 

Ethiopia:

Ethiopia first-grade sesame (2016-2017 season) from direct suppliers: FOB 1,180-1,230 USD/MT for November shipments.

Ethiopia second-grade sesame (2016-2017 season) from direct suppliers: FOB 1,130-1,180USD/MT for November shipments.

Sudan:

Sudan white sesame (2016-2017 season) CNF price:1,190-1,210USD/MT for November shipments.

India:

India new white sesame (99/1/1 white sesame) is quoted at CNF 1,070  1,090USD/MT for November shipments.

Nigeria:

Nigeria oilseeds (2016-2017 season):FOB 1,050 USD/MT for November shipments.

Mali:

Mali mixed sesame (2016-2017 season): FOB 1,060 USD/MT for November shipments.

Togo:

Togo mixed sesame (2016-2017 season): FOB 1,050 USD/MT for November shipments.

Togo white sesame (2016-2017 season): FOB 1,090 USD/MT for November shipments.

Tanzania:

Tanzania mixed sesame (2016-2017 season): CNF 1,100 USD/MT for November shipments

Tanzania quality sesame (2016-2017 season):CNF 1,150 USD/MT for November shipments

Mozambique:

Mozambique quality sesame (2016-2017 season): CNF 1,140 USD/MT for November shipments

Ethiopian ECX Exchange Situation:

This week the ECX has no updates. There is no transaction information.

Market Analysis

From what we gathered, currently the 1-grade white from Ethiopia is quoted at FOB 1,210 USD/MT and India 99/1/1 white sesame at CNF 1,070-1,090USD/T. Now the Tanzania and Mozambique new sesame begin to go into the market in a big quantity. In the early period, the Japanese importers bought some future goods from Tanzania at 1,150USD/T. But now the exporters in East Africa quote the new sesame at CNF 1,100--1,160USD/T.

According to China Customs Administration E-Port & China Custom data survey: In the month of August, 2017, China imported 54811529 kg sesame at the price of 1.053 USD/kg,19771310 kg from Tanzania at the price of 1.035 USD/kg ,15342463 kg from Ethiopia at the price of 1.112 USD/kg and 5143620 kg from Sudan at the price of 1.145 USD/kg. According to what we know, there has been some new sesame into the market in Hunan and Hubei. The opening price is higher than that in the last year (at about 10.200--10,400RMB/T).But the sales is slow.

According to what we know, the Middle Autumn Day and National Day is in the same time this year. The marked demand will become larger. The downstream companies begin to stock the goods gradually. This will be good for the sesame market at the port.

According to what we got from the port, the price depends on the quality. If it has a good quality, its price will be higher. On the contrary, it will be cheaper. If it is the new goods and the products with good quality, its price is higher. It is still the buyer market at the port. The inventory at the port has less than that in the same period in the last year. The high inventory pressure has been released gradually. What we should pay more attention is that it sales quickly at the port and the inventory is reduced quickly, too.
